

She was born on February 10, 1949 in Donaldsonville, LA. She was a member of St. Alphonsus Catholic church, attended St. Gerard Majella Catholic Church and graduated in 1967 from Redemptorist High School. She worked for St. Alphonsus Catholic Church Rectory and worked for Dr. Gerard Bossier, D.D.S. She was an avid LSU Baseball and Football fan.
She was preceded in death by her parents; Godfrey and Dorothy Landry; brother, Ramsey Landry and two grandpups, Maverick and Bella.
She is survived by her husband of 52 years, Peter L. Brocato; three children, Scott Brocato, Jeffrey Brocato (Michelle) and Lauren Brocato Zimmer (Rusty); brother, David Landry (Cindy); two sisters, Brenda Guidry (Tommy) and Peggy Wagley (Robert); grandson, Cole Brocato; two grandpups, Cali and Jax and numerous other family members.
